Tabitha Health Care Services—ushering in its 125th year of service—has restructured the leadership team to meet the current and future needs of Elders throughout the 29-county service area.

Kristine Dykeman-Schoening has been named Executive Director of Continuum overseeing Case Management, Admissions, Adult Day Services and the two independent living communities, Tabitha Village in central Lincoln and Walter Apartments in Autumnwood.

Charity Ebert, RN, MSN, was promoted to Executive Director of Operations/Home Care and is responsible for oversight of Tabitha’s three home care programs: Home Health Care (Medicare Certified), Hospice (Medicare Certified), and Home Care Specialties (private pay), serving Tabitha’s entire service area. Ebert joined Tabitha in 2009 as Assistant Administrator of Tabitha Home Health Care.

Joyce Ebmeier will serve as Senior Vice President of Strategic Planning & Communications responsible for directing and coordinating the planning, evaluation, communication and progress of Tabitha’s business and strategic plans.

Jeremy Hohlen has been named Executive Director of Operations/Living Communities with oversight of Tabitha Nursing & Rehabilitation Center and GracePointe Assisted Living, both in Lincoln, and Tabitha’s facilities in Crete—the Nursing Center and Garden Square Assisted Living—as well as managing Lakeview Care Center in Firth.

Chief Financial Officer Dave Jackson, will serve as Senior Vice President heading the Financial Services Division which supports the entire organization.
Rick Lindquist has been named Vice President of Human Resources and is now responsible for volunteers, corporate education and employee wellness and medical services.
